Priority Banking Clients:
  • SGX: 0.18% brokerage rate
  • Other Markets: 0.20% brokerage rate
  • Minimum Brokerage Amount: $0
Personal Banking Clients:
  • SGX: 0.20% brokerage rate

  • Other Markets: 0.25% brokerage rate

  • Minimum Brokerage Amount:
    • $10 for shares traded in AUD, CHF, GBP, SGD, and USD (plus GST)

    • ¥1000 for shares traded in JPY (plus GST)

    • $100 for shares traded in HKD (plus GST)
If there is no minimum brokerage fee for priority banking I will probably get 100 units of stock and park to earn the additional 0.5% interest. 😜
